Billy Carlson
Product and UX designer
As a Product and UX Design leader with over 15 years of experience, I've had the privilege of designing and leading teams across e-commerce, finance, SaaS, and more. I specialize in creating user-centric strategies and simplifying complex systems into intuitive products that drive engagement, satisfaction, and business success.
Most recently, I've led a team at KPMG Canada, focusing on enhancing client-facing business tools, while advocating for the adoption of design systems to streamline development processes.
I co-wrote Wireframing for Everyone.
❤️ Most loved
Rapid wireframing with Balsamiq
17 button design best practices to make users actually click
Discover how to design buttons that look clickable, feel intuitive, and encourage action. Get smart about structure, copy, and flow.

Use wireframes to develop your designer’s eye
Even if you don’t call yourself a designer, there are some easy tips and techniques to help you see a digital product and its usability like a designer.

The process behind improving the Firefox application menu
Interview with Betsy Mikel about what it takes to improve Mozilla Firefox’s application menu: gather the data, use wireframes, validate with user research.

Advice for getting started in UX design
Advice and recommended resources for how to get into UX from your friends at Balsamiq

Designing effective data tables
Big data can cause big problems for clean, usable interface designs. Here are some easy-to-understand tips to ensure that your data applications are easy to use.

Ten principles of effective wireframes
Guiding principles to help designers wireframe better and encourage the entire team to participate in the design process.

The process behind starting a project content first
A conversation with Content Designer Emileigh Barnes about content, why it’s so important to think content-first, and how to use wireframing as a writer.

The process behind creating a new digital product
A conversation with Founder and CEO Justin Mitchell about design process, the importance of understanding requirements, and how to take an idea and make it real.

The process behind creating products with user-centered design
A conversation with Co-founder Ben Ihnchak about user-centered design, research methods and why he believes spending time on wireframes is really important.

The process behind treating coding like design
A conversation with Software Engineer Iheanyi Ekechukwu about side projects, objective feedback, and communication between developers and designers.

Best practices for designing e-commerce sites
Tips to improve the shopping experience on your e-commerce site and present top-notch product listing pages, product detail pages, and cart designs to your visitors.

Four simple rules for effective website forms
Follow these 4 simple, basic principles of form design to see higher completion rates, fewer errors, and a better experience on your website’s forms.

How to use visual hierarchy and alignment to improve UI design
Proper element hierarchy and alignment will make your website or app easy to scan. Learn how to drive users' attention and guide them to the next action.

The process behind creating the app Hello Weather
A conversation with Product Designer Jonas Downey about creating a weather app, what it’s like to run an app as a business, and tips for future Product Designers.

Copying an existing UI to learn how it was designed
Through the exercise of copying an existing app or website using wireframes you’ll get to know how it was designed and why some UI choices were made.

The process behind getting started with a product idea
A conversation with Co-founder Shay Howe about building his 1-on-1 meeting assistance tool Lead Honestly and starting with words, or no-fidelity.

The process behind designing complex dashboards
A conversation with Product Designer Camay Ho about the process behind redesigning a complex dashboard: research, idea exploration, wireframing, user testing.

The process behind wireframing with developers
A conversation with Director of Engineering Nick Barger about the role of design in creating something new from the perspective of a non-designer.

Wireframing mobile applications
We cover the basics of mobile wireframing: design patterns that are unique to phones, common native mobile interactions, and tips for designing your app.

Wireframing for site-builder applications
Site builders have almost endless options to customize. That can be dangerous. Starting with wireframes makes the process of choosing and editing templates easier.

Content-first design: Let the content determine the design
Content is design. By starting with a content-first mindset, you will ensure that the user interface evolves to support what's inside it.

Content-first design with wireframes - Webinar
What does it mean content-first design, and how can you do it with wireframes? You’ll also learn about some real-life examples of content-first projects.
Copying to learn with wireframes - Webinar
In this webinar we show you why copying is a great way to learn not only craft, but UI Design too! And we teach you how to do it using wireframes with a live demo.
How to design effective data tables with wireframes - Webinar
Tips and tricks on how to make data tables easy to read and understand. What are the most common design pitfalls? How do you overcome them? Free webinar recording.
A hands-on introduction to UI design with wireframes - Webinar
Harnessing visual hierarchy, proper alignment, and clarity within your wireframes will elevate them from simple sketches to effective product design artifacts.
How to ideate like a designer for product managers - Webinar
Easy tips we learned that you can use during the ideation phase of your design process: ask designerly questions, use what if prompts, and throw away the rulebook.
Rapid wireframing with Balsamiq
Free course on how to use Balsamiq Cloud to create wireframes of a digital product quickly. Lots of design tips and tricks by Billy Carlson, author and UX educator.